Key differences
- Thickness: Aero is thinner by 1mm (16 mm vs 17 mm) — often feels firmer and more pop-leaning.
- Core material: HoldTEK Polymer Core vs Polypropylene Narrow-Cell Honeycomb
- Face material: Raw Carbon Fiber vs Kevlar/Carbon
